Aquaculture Funding at New Hampshire Uni

US - The National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ration (NOAA) will give $355,000 to the University of New Hampshire, US to invest in new aquaculture research.

According to AllAboutFeed.net, these funds will allow the university to research technologies for reducing damage to offshore cages by marine organisms and to develop new depth control technologies for optimizing fish feeding, metabolism, stress reduction and growth.

"We are very pleased with the support of our open ocean aquaculture research" said Dr. Richard Langan, Director of the Atlantic Marine Aquaculture Center.
